HHHHHHHelp You like to watch movies at the local cinema. You have two payment options. Option A is to buy a discount card, which

will cost you $160, and then $10 per movie. Option B is to pay $50 per movie. After how many movies will the total costs of the two options be the same

Answer:

After 4 movies it will be equal

Step-by-step explanation:

10x + 160 = 50x

160 = 40x

4 = x

Check:

10x + 160 =

10(4) + 160 =

40 + 160 = 200

50x =

50 x 4 = 200

200 = 200
